N2 - A broadband patch loaded substrate-integrated cavity backed slot antenna (SICBAS) is proposed for 5G millimeter-wave (mmW) communications. The proposed antenna utilizes a compact symmetrical substrate-integrated cavity (SIC) to excite 2× 4 E-shaped patches through coupling slots, and it achieves an impedance bandwidth (vert S_11vert < -10textdB) of 38.2-53.8 GHz with a gain of 13-15.4 dBi over 41-55 GHz. Incorporating with a 16-way power divider, the SICBAS is extended to a 4× 4 array to achieve a higher gain greater than 22.5 dBi over 40-51 GHz. The proposed SICBSA array is fabricated and measured, which demonstrates that it is very promising for mmW broadband applications.
